Femboy Hot Springs is a casual indie game set on PC that blends visual novel storytelling with light management elements in a snowy Japanese hot spring inn. Players step into the role of Kazuki, a 24-year-old who leaves behind city burnout to take over his late grandfather's traditional inn, Yumegiri-sō. The experience centers on daily routines, relationship building, and personal growth during one winter season, all wrapped in a cozy atmosphere of warm waters and cold mountain nights.
Gameplay
The core loop involves managing the inn's operations while getting to know its residents. Kazuki handles tasks like cooking meals, performing repairs, balancing the books, and completing winter chores through simple minigames. These activities tie directly into the narrative, as success or choices during them influence how the other characters respond and open up. Dialogue options appear frequently during conversations, letting players shape interactions and decide how close to grow with each resident. The game emphasizes consent and mutual trust in its adult scenes, which appear in romance paths and focus on emotional connection rather than isolated encounters. Progression feels deliberate, with the winter timeframe creating a sense of limited time to turn the inn's fortunes around before debts force a sale.
Game Modes
Players follow one of four distinct romance routes, each centered on a different resident and offering its own emotional arc, intimate moments, and set of endings. Good endings reward strong bonds, normal endings reflect balanced but imperfect outcomes, and bittersweet parting endings explore the realities of change and separation. An alternative path skips romance entirely for a platonic found-family conclusion that highlights themes of belonging and shared purpose. No competitive or multiplayer elements exist; the focus stays on single-player narrative choices and their consequences across multiple playthroughs.
Story and Characters
Kazuki arrives at an inn facing leaks, empty rooms, and looming financial pressure from a rival resort. He meets four adult residents who already call the place home: Yuki, whose quiet affection shows through carefully prepared meals; Haru, whose energetic approach keeps the boiler and group morale steady; Rin, who has shouldered the accounting burdens alone; and Sora, whose mysterious knowledge of the grandfather adds layers to the family legacy. Each character's personal fears, dreams, and attachment to the inn unfold through repeated interactions. The story explores healing from burnout, the value of community, and what it means to fight for a home that might save its caretaker in return.
